Philips Achieva 3.0T MRI Coil Seal Adhesive May Fail, Risking Patient Injury
The Quadrature Body Coil seal adhesive in Philips Achieva 3.0T MRI scanners may fail, creating sharp edges that can injure patients. All units with model numbers 781277, 781177, 781278, 781344, and 781345 are affected.

Plain-English summary
Philips North America is recalling the Achieva 3.0T mag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) scanner, models 781277, 781177, 781278, 781344, and 781345. The device contains a Quadrature Body Coil (QBC) with a seal adhesive that may fail under normal operating conditions.
If the QBC seal fails during the scanning process, sharp edges may develop and make contact with patients. This can result in skin abrasions, bruises, lacerations, hair loss or entanglement, and tissue injury.
Approximately 75 units were distributed in the United States, and 442 units were distributed outside the US. Healthcare facilities operating affected equipment should discontinue use and contact Philips North America for repair or replacement instructions. Patients who may have used the equipment should contact their healthcare provider if they develop any cuts, abrasions, or other injuries.
